Question 2

After giving the first dose of any antihypertensive drug for heart failure, what action must the nurse take for patient safety?
 
  a. Recheck the drug order for accuracy.
  b. Ensure that the call light is within reach.
  c. Place a wheelchair in the patient's room.
  d. Raise all four siderails on the patient's bed.

Answer to Question 2

B
Antihypertensive drugs decrease blood pressure and increase a patient's risk for dizziness, light-headedness, and hypotension. After giving the first dose of any antihypertensive drug, the nurse should be sure that the call light is within easy reach and instruct the patient to call for as-sistance when getting out of bed. A wheelchair is not necessary and standards of practice state that the nurse should not raise all four siderails because there is a risk for falls if the patient tries to get out of bed alone.

Bisphosphonates were first developed in the nineteenth century. They were first investigated for use in disorders of bone metabolism in the 1960s. They are now used clinically for the treatment of osteoporosis, Paget's disease, bone metastasis, multiple myeloma, and other conditions that feature bone fragility.

A cataract is a clouding of the eyes' natural lens. As we age, some clouding of the lens may occur. The first sign of a cataract is usually blurry vision. Although glasses and other visual aids may at first help a person with cataracts, surgery may become inevitable. Cataract surgery is very successful in restoring vision, and it is the most frequently performed surgery in the United States.

Glaucoma is a leading cause of blindness. As of yet, there is no cure. Everyone is at risk, and there may be no warning signs. It is six to eight times more common in African Americans than in whites. The best and most effective way to detect glaucoma is to receive a dilated eye examination.

The liver is the only organ that has the ability to regenerate itself after certain types of damage. As much as 25% of the liver can be removed, and it will still regenerate back to its original shape and size. However, the liver cannot regenerate after severe damage caused by alcohol.
